**Q: Does Fernpost strip EXIF data from user avatars?**

Yes. All avatar uploads run through the MetaWipe filter, which removes location, device, and timestamp tags before storage. Reviewers should confirm any new image endpoint calls MetaWipe explicitly, since it is not applied at the storage layer. The retained-tag list lives on the internal page.

runbook for tafof-yawif: https://confluence.tolvaqsys.internal/display/display/browse/pages/7be3

Handover: tailcat CLI (Marisol → incoming contractor)

The tailcat CLI streams logs from the Brindlewood aggregator. Always pass --env explicitly; the default silently points at staging. Filters are regex-based and case-sensitive, which trips people up. Rate limits kick in above 500 lines/sec, so narrow your query first. The service reads the following configuration values at startup.

service settings:
[silwyn]
host = silwyn.crelvogrid.internal
user = silwyn_svc
database = silwyn_prod

Audit item 14: Autocomplete index latency. The Quickfind suggestion index on the Marlowe cluster shows p95 lookups above 400ms, traced to unbounded prefix fan-out. Verify the fix caps fan-out at three shards and that the nightly rebuild job completes within its window. Confirm benchmarks are attached to the pull request before approving. The remediation and follow-up measurements are owned by:

account owner for bawip-tahag: Raleth Quenok

## Runbook: Dark Mode — Greywarden Admin

Dark mode ships behind a flag. Theme tokens resolve server-side; client falls back to light on error. Rollout: staging first, then the Fennmark tenant cohort. Rollback is flag-off, no deploy needed. Known issue: chart legends ignore the palette until cache clears (~5 min). To run the theming service locally, copy `env.sample` to `.env`; defaults are fine except the token-store credential, which it can't start without. Append this line to `.env`:

sealed setting: VAULT_KEY20=c8ea1e419912889df6b4